Category: BreakfastServings: 8Total Time: 9 hrs 30 mins1. Spray 13x9-inch (3-quart) baking dish with cooking spray. Separate dough into 8 biscuits; cut each biscuit into 8 pieces. Arrange evenly in baking dish.
2. Top biscuits with potatoes, frozen sausage, bacon, green onions and 1 1/2 cups of the cheese. Set aside.
3. In large bowl, beat eggs, half-and-half, salt and pepper with whisk until well blended. Pour evenly over biscuit mixture in baking dish. Cover; refrigerate at least 8 hours or overnight.
4. Heat oven to 350°F. Uncover baking dish. Sprinkle with remaining 1/2 cup cheese. Bake 48 to 53 minutes or until center is set and edges are deep golden brown. Let stand 15 minutes before serving. Cover and refrigerate leftovers.
